Erasmus+, Klíčová Akce 1: tréninkový kurz (PDA = professional development event)
Časová osa této mobility:
- videohovor se všemi účastníky: na přelom března a dubna (přesný termín bude určen v průběhu března)
- tréninkový kurz: 23.—30. duben 2026, Ommen, Nizozemí
- zorganizování dvou místních aktivit (ve své komunitě, kroužku, organizaci, atp.) ve kterých zúročíš své získané schopnosti/dovednosti z tohoto tréninkového kurzu
Český tým: 5 účastníků – pracovníků s mládeží (ve věku 20-26 let) věk. limit není striktní – je důležité splňovat profil účastníků

Pro to, abyste se na tento projekt přihlásili je nutné, abyste vlastnili nejen občanský průkaz (který musíte mít ze zákona), ale také platný cestovní pas (s platností min. ještě 150 dní od datumu začátku vámi vybraného projektu).
V rámci programu ERASMUS+ jsou následující finanční specifika: v rámci všech projektů je kompletně (ze 100%) zajištěno jídlo, ubytování, aktivity, a to vše je zcela pokryto z fondů EU programu ERASMUS+ a zařízeno organizátory. Účastníkům dále budou proplaceny cestovní náklady (reimbursement) z místa bydliště do místa konání projektu a to dle způsobu dopravy:
- €309 – v případě letecké dopravy. Účastníci, kteří na projekt poletí také budou platit €75/účastník poplatek hostitelské organizaci
- €417 v případě ‚zelené‘ pozemní dopravy (autobusy, vlaky). Zelená doprava = min. 51% celkové cesty je absolvováno autobusy/vlaky. Účastníci cestující zeleně účastnický poplatek neplatí.
Účastníkům bude proplacen celý rozpočet na cest. náklady bez ohledu na to, na kolik účastníky jejich reálné cest. náklady vyjdou. V případě zelené dopravy účastníkovi bude vyplaceno €417 a v případě letecké dopravy €234. Na rozpočet pro zelenou dopravu máte nárok i v případě, že využijete jednoho letu (důležité je, aby 51% celkové cesty bylo vykonáno po zemi = autobusy, vlaky).
Pokud tedy využijete pozemní dopravy (např. linkami do Amsterdamu s FlixBusem), svou účastí na projektu si ještě vyděláte.

Popis projektu:
SHIFT is an immersive, experience-based training for youth workers and trainers.
Do you work with people and want to grow as a trainer or facilitator?
Do you believe learning starts from connection and being present?
Are you curious about turning unexpected moments into learning opportunities?
SHIFT was born from one of the biggest challenges youth workers face today.
From our perspective, this challenge is recognizing and turning everyday, unpredictable moments into meaningful learning opportunities. Many professionals, especially those with a strong formal education background or less hands-on mentoring experience, feel unsure when the script changes, time is short, or the group dynamic requires an immediate and flexible response.
One common example → even though youth workers often know in theory that the learning process belongs to the group and not to them as trainers, when unexpected situations arise, they may try to save the moment themselves or freeze. Instead, they could adapt, stay present, and still give the group the chance to take responsibility for their own process, while supporting them from the outside.
This becomes even more relevant today, as the realities of youth work are constantly changing: groups are often different from what is expected, circumstances can change at the last minute, and preparation time is limited. In these situations, youth workers can quickly feel overwhelmed and fall back on pre-prepared scripts, missing valuable opportunities for learning and connection. Often, the instinct is to stick to the plan, even though much more learning could emerge by working with what is happening in the moment.
Does this sound familiar?
It is clear that the core aim of SHIFT is not to deliver “better” workshops, but to strengthen your ability to recognize learning as it happens. The focus is on tools and approaches that help you identify learning in simple situations, adapt activities to the real needs of young people, and make meaningful interventions when it matters most. Instead of delivering pre-prepared activities that participants simply “go through,” you will learn how to stay present, work from connection, and guide individual and group processes. This allows you to focus more on people than on programs, creating impact one person at a time.

We will work with a clear methodological approach called developmental facilitation. It combines elements of youth coaching and mentoring in action. When integrated into your own facilitation style and combined with non-formal education, it supports both personal growth and professional impact. The strength of shift lies in learning together with peers. Everyone in the group faces similar challenges in their work, while bringing different experiences and coping strategies. This creates a rich learning environment.
This approach supports you in staying flexible and choosing appropriate interventions in the moment.
You will work on two levels:
- personal: you will participate, practice, and reflect on your own development as a trainer, while taking part in a high-quality learning experience.
- proffesional: you will test and apply new tools, methods, and approaches, shaping them into your own practice.
At ImpACT, we strongly believe that personal and professional development go hand in hand. The longterm value of this training should be visible in how you work with people and groups afterwards.

Who is this project for?/participants‘ profile:
The main target group of SHIFT is youth workers, as defined in the Erasmus+ program = these are people who work directly with young people, either as professionals or as active volunteers. In our project, this includes facilitators, educators, mentors, coaches, trainers, and young people who already take responsibility for guiding groups or organizing learning activities in their communities.
This project is for you if you:
- are interested in developing their competences and contributing to the quality of youth work;
- are a young professional between 20 and 26 years old;
- already have some experience in group work, facilitation, or youth activities;
- are familiar with identifying needs, working with available resources, and designing activities, but come from a more formal education background or have limited space to practice in nonformal settings;
- are motivated, creative and committed;
- are interested in applying what you learn after the project, both in follow-up activities and in your ongoing work at home;
- are able to communicate and work in English fluently.
